OEM Auto Parts

OEM (Original Equipment Manufacturer) auto parts are components made by the vehicle’s original manufacturer. They are designed to meet the exact specifications and standards of the vehicle. B2B buyers often prefer OEM parts for their reliability and compatibility, especially when conducting repairs or restorations. However, these parts typically come at a premium price, which may not be ideal for businesses with tight budgets.

Aftermarket Parts

Aftermarket parts are manufactured by companies other than the original vehicle maker. They often provide a wider variety of options at lower prices, making them appealing to cost-conscious B2B buyers. However, the quality of aftermarket parts can vary significantly, so it is crucial for buyers to vet suppliers and consider warranty options. These parts are commonly used in general repairs and modifications.

Performance Parts

Performance parts are designed to enhance a vehicle’s power, handling, and overall performance. These components are especially popular in racing and high-performance vehicle markets. B2B buyers looking to improve vehicle performance should consider the potential benefits, but they should also be aware that using such parts can void warranties and may require specialized installation knowledge.

Specialty Parts

Specialty parts cater to unique vehicle types or specific uses, such as custom builds or niche markets. These components are often tailored solutions, making them invaluable for businesses that focus on custom automotive work. However, availability can be limited, and costs may be higher than standard parts. Buyers should assess the demand for such parts within their market to ensure a return on investment.

Re-manufactured Parts

Re-manufactured parts are used components that have been restored to meet OEM specifications. They provide a cost-effective alternative for businesses looking to maintain fleets or perform general repairs without the expense of new parts. While re-manufactured parts often come with warranties, buyers should consider the potential for a shorter lifespan compared to brand-new components.

Manufacturing Processes for Auto Parts

The manufacturing of auto parts typically involves several key stages, each critical to ensuring the final product meets the required standards. The main stages include:

  1. Material Preparation
    – The process begins with the selection of raw materials, which may include metals, plastics, and composites. Buyers should look for suppliers that use high-quality materials to ensure durability and performance.
    – Material inspection is conducted to verify that the specifications meet industry standards before proceeding to the next stage.

  2. Forming
    – This stage involves shaping the raw materials into the desired form through various techniques such as stamping, forging, casting, or injection molding.
    – Techniques like CNC machining are often employed for precision parts, allowing for tighter tolerances and better fitment in assemblies.

  3. Assembly
    – In this phase, various components are brought together to create the final product. This may involve mechanical fastening, welding, or adhesive bonding.
    – Automation is increasingly being used in assembly lines to enhance efficiency and reduce human error.

  4. Finishing
    – The final stage includes surface treatment processes such as painting, coating, or polishing to enhance appearance and protect against corrosion.
    – Quality checks are performed post-finishing to ensure the aesthetic and functional qualities meet the specifications.

Key Manufacturing Techniques

  • Lean Manufacturing: Many manufacturers adopt lean principles to reduce waste and increase efficiency. This is particularly beneficial for B2B buyers as it can lead to lower costs and faster turnaround times.
  • Just-in-Time (JIT): This inventory strategy minimizes stock levels and reduces holding costs, ensuring that parts are manufactured only as needed. Buyers should inquire if suppliers use JIT to optimize their supply chain.
  • Advanced Manufacturing Technologies: The use of technologies such as 3D printing and automation is on the rise. These innovations can provide custom solutions and quick prototyping capabilities, which can be advantageous for buyers needing specific parts.

Quality Assurance in Auto Parts Manufacturing

Quality assurance is paramount in the manufacturing of auto parts, ensuring that products are safe, reliable, and compliant with international standards. Key aspects include:

  1. International Standards Compliance
    ISO 9001: This standard focuses on quality management systems (QMS). Manufacturers in Beaverton often seek ISO certification to demonstrate their commitment to quality.
    CE Marking: For parts sold in Europe, CE marking indicates compliance with EU safety, health, and environmental requirements.
    API Standards: For automotive parts related to engines and fluids, adherence to API standards ensures high performance and reliability.

  2. Quality Control Checkpoints
    Incoming Quality Control (IQC): Raw materials are inspected upon arrival to ensure they meet specified standards.
    In-Process Quality Control (IPQC): Continuous monitoring during production helps identify defects early in the manufacturing process.
    Final Quality Control (FQC): The final inspection checks the assembled product against specifications before shipping.

  3. Testing Methods
    – Common testing methods include:

    • Dimensional Inspection: Ensures parts are manufactured to precise specifications.
    • Functional Testing: Verifies that parts operate correctly under expected conditions.
    • Durability Testing: Assesses the lifespan and performance of parts under stress.

Cost Components

  1. Materials: The type of materials used in the production of auto parts significantly impacts the overall cost. High-quality raw materials may incur higher costs but can lead to superior durability and performance. For instance, sourcing OEM parts from renowned brands like Bosch or Brembo may come at a premium, but they often justify the price with quality assurance.

  2. Labor: Labor costs in Beaverton, Oregon, are influenced by local wage standards and the expertise required for manufacturing auto parts. Skilled labor, especially for specialized components, can increase production costs, which may be reflected in the final pricing.

  3. Manufacturing Overhead: This includes utilities, facility maintenance, and administrative expenses associated with production. Efficient manufacturing processes can help minimize overhead costs, enabling suppliers to offer competitive pricing.

  4. Tooling: Investment in tooling, which encompasses molds and dies necessary for production, can be substantial. Buyers should consider whether the supplier has the capability to produce specialized parts that may require unique tooling, as this can affect both lead time and pricing.

  5. Quality Control (QC): Rigorous QC processes ensure that parts meet industry standards and specifications. Suppliers with comprehensive QC measures may charge higher prices, but this can lead to lower failure rates and decreased total cost of ownership.

  6. Logistics: Transportation costs are critical, especially for international buyers. Factors such as shipping methods, distances, and customs duties can add significant expenses. Understanding the logistics involved in sourcing parts from Beaverton is essential for accurate budgeting.

  7. Margin: Suppliers typically include a profit margin in their pricing to ensure sustainability. This margin can vary based on market demand, competition, and the uniqueness of the parts being offered.

Price Influencers

  • Volume/MOQ (Minimum Order Quantity): Larger orders often qualify for bulk pricing discounts. Buyers should evaluate their needs and consider consolidating orders to take advantage of lower unit prices.

  • Specifications/Customization: Customized parts generally command higher prices due to the additional resources and time required for production. Buyers should weigh the necessity of customization against potential cost increases.

  • Quality/Certifications: Parts that meet specific quality certifications or standards may be priced higher. Investing in certified parts can lead to long-term savings by reducing maintenance and replacement costs.

  • Supplier Factors: The reputation and reliability of the supplier can influence pricing. Established suppliers may charge more due to their brand value and trustworthiness, while newer entrants might offer lower prices to gain market share.

  • Incoterms: Understanding the Incoterms agreed upon (e.g., FOB, CIF) is crucial for international buyers, as they define the responsibilities of buyers and sellers in shipping and logistics, directly impacting overall costs.

Critical Specifications

  1. Material Grade
    Definition: Material grade refers to the classification of the material based on its composition, strength, and other physical properties.
    B2B Importance: Understanding the material grade is essential for ensuring that the auto parts meet specific performance standards and regulatory requirements. For instance, parts made from high-grade steel may provide greater durability and resistance to wear, which is critical in automotive applications.

  2. Tolerance
    Definition: Tolerance is the permissible limit of variation in a physical dimension of a part.
    B2B Importance: Tight tolerances are crucial in ensuring that parts fit together correctly, which is vital for safety and functionality. Inaccurate tolerances can lead to mechanical failure or increased wear and tear, affecting the overall reliability of the vehicle.

  3. Finish Type
    Definition: Finish type refers to the surface treatment of the parts, such as coatings, plating, or polishing.
    B2B Importance: Different finish types can enhance corrosion resistance, reduce friction, and improve aesthetic appeal. Buyers should choose the appropriate finish based on the intended use of the parts and environmental conditions they will face.

  4. Load Rating
    Definition: Load rating indicates the maximum load that a part can safely handle.
    B2B Importance: This specification is critical for components such as suspension parts and bearings. Buyers need to ensure that the load rating meets or exceeds the requirements of the vehicle’s design to prevent failures during operation.

  5. Compatibility
    Definition: Compatibility refers to whether a part can be used with specific vehicle makes and models.
    B2B Importance: Ensuring compatibility is essential to avoid costly returns and delays. Parts must be verified against OEM specifications to ensure they fit and function correctly in the intended vehicle.

Common Trade Terms

  1. OEM (Original Equipment Manufacturer)
    Definition: OEM refers to companies that manufacture parts that are used in the assembly of a vehicle, often producing parts that meet the original specifications.
    Importance: OEM parts are typically preferred for their guaranteed quality and fit. Understanding the difference between OEM and aftermarket parts helps buyers select the right components for their needs.

  2. MOQ (Minimum Order Quantity)
    Definition: MOQ is the smallest quantity of a product that a supplier is willing to sell.
    Importance: Knowing the MOQ is essential for buyers to manage inventory levels and procurement costs. It helps in planning orders and negotiating better deals.

  3. RFQ (Request for Quotation)
    Definition: An RFQ is a document issued by a buyer to solicit price proposals from suppliers.
    Importance: Using RFQs allows buyers to compare costs and services from different suppliers, ensuring they get the best value for their procurement budget.

  4. Incoterms (International Commercial Terms)
    Definition: Incoterms are standardized terms that define the responsibilities of buyers and sellers in international transactions.
    Importance: Understanding Incoterms is crucial for international buyers to clarify shipping responsibilities, risk transfer, and cost allocation. This knowledge helps prevent disputes and ensures smooth transactions.

  5. Aftermarket
    Definition: The aftermarket refers to the market for parts and accessories that are not sourced from the OEM but are used to replace or upgrade vehicle components.
    Importance: Buyers should understand the aftermarket landscape as it often provides more cost-effective solutions and a wider range of options than OEM parts.
